What Factors Should You Consider When Choosing a Budget Off-Road Air Compressor?

When choosing a budget off-road air compressor, consider the following factors:

  1. Compressor Type
  2. Maximum Pressure
  3. Air Flow Rate
  4. Portability
  5. Durability
  6. Power Source
  7. Hose Length

These factors play a significant role in the effectiveness and convenience of using an off-road air compressor. Each factor presents variation in attributes that may cater to different user needs.

  1. Compressor Type: The compressor type significantly influences performance. There are typically two types: portable electric compressors and heavy-duty vehicle-mounted compressors. Portable electric compressors are lighter and easier to store, while mounted compressors deliver higher performance for heavy use.

  2. Maximum Pressure: The maximum pressure a compressor can achieve is crucial. Most off-road air compressors range from 25 PSI to 200 PSI. Higher PSI allows for quicker inflation of larger tires.

  3. Air Flow Rate: The air flow rate, measured in liters per minute (LPM) or cubic feet per minute (CFM), determines how quickly the compressor can inflate tires. A higher air flow rate is preferable for off-road applications to minimize waiting time during tire inflation.

  4. Portability: Portability relates to the weight and size of the air compressor. Compacts models are easier to carry and store but may compromise power. Assess your vehicle’s cargo space before choosing a compressor size.

  5. Durability: Durability is vital for off-road conditions. Look for compressors made with robust materials that can withstand harsh weather and rough handling. A well-constructed compressor will provide longer service life.

  6. Power Source: The power source varies among compressors. Options include 12V car batteries, 110V wall outlets, or even gas-powered models. A 12V compressor is generally most practical for off-road enthusiasts since it connects directly to the vehicle’s battery.

  7. Hose Length: The hose length affects the compressor’s reach. A longer hose provides more flexibility and allows you to service multiple tires or different areas around your vehicle without moving the compressor.

In summary, these factors collectively inform the best choice of a budget off-road air compressor. Evaluating them according to your specific requirements will ensure you select a suitable model for your off-road adventures.

How Does PSI Impact the Efficiency of Off-Road Tire Inflation?

PSI impacts the efficiency of off-road tire inflation significantly. PSI stands for pounds per square inch, which measures the air pressure within a tire. Higher PSI values can lead to efficient fuel consumption and help maintain vehicle speed on hard surfaces. Conversely, lower PSI improves traction on soft or uneven terrain.

When inflating off-road tires, it is essential to consider the terrain type. For rocky or rugged paths, lower PSI allows the tire to conform better to obstacles. This action enhances grip and prevents tire damage. On the other hand, for sandy or loose surfaces, a higher PSI is preferable to avoid sinking.

The optimal PSI for off-road tires usually falls between 12 to 18 PSI, depending on the vehicle and terrain. Maintaining the correct PSI ensures better handling, improves vehicle performance, and extends tire life.

In summary, understanding and adjusting PSI according to off-road conditions directly impacts inflation efficiency, traction, and overall vehicle performance.

How Do You Choose the Best Budget Off-Road Air Compressor from the Available Options?

To choose the best budget off-road air compressor, consider key factors such as power output, inflation speed, portability, durability, and noise levels.

Power output: An air compressor’s efficiency often relates to its power. Look for models with a sufficient PSI (pounds per square inch) rating. Generally, a minimum of 30 PSI is recommended for inflating standard off-road tires. High-performance models can reach up to 150 PSI.

Inflation speed: The time it takes to inflate tires can vary significantly between models. Some compressors can inflate a mid-sized tire in under 4 minutes, while others may take over 10 minutes. Understanding your needs will help you choose a compressor with an adequate inflation speed based on the tire sizes you typically use.

Portability: An ideal off-road air compressor should be lightweight and compact for easy transport. Look for models with built-in carrying handles or storage options for cables and hoses. Compactness matters, especially when you have limited cargo space.

Durability: Off-road environments can be harsh. Choose an air compressor designed with rugged materials, protective casings, and heat-resistant components. Models with higher IP ratings (Ingress Protection) offer better resistance to dust and water.

Noise levels: While compressors can generate significant noise, some models operate more quietly than others. Check the decibel levels (dB) to ensure that the compressor won’t be overly disruptive during operation, especially in remote settings.

Price point: Budget options vary widely, typically ranging from $30 to $150. Set a limit based on your budget but also consider the balance of cost and quality to avoid sacrificing crucial features.

Customer reviews: Analyze customer feedback and ratings. Reviews from other users can provide insights into the compressor’s performance, reliability, and usability. Aim for products with a good balance of positive feedback.

Warranty: Lastly, a solid warranty can safeguard your investment. Look for brands that offer at least a one-year warranty, which indicates confidence in their product.

By evaluating these factors, you make an informed decision that aligns with your off-roading needs and budget constraints.

How Can You Ensure Safe Tire Inflation in Off-Road Conditions?

To ensure safe tire inflation in off-road conditions, you should use a reliable air compressor, monitor tire pressure accurately, and consider the terrain.

Using a reliable air compressor: Choose a compressor specifically designed for off-road use. Off-road conditions can lead to punctured tires, making a durable compressor essential. Select a model that provides sufficient airflow and pressure. Many off-road compressors deliver 2.0 to 3.0 CFM (cubic feet per minute). This ensures quick inflation of larger tires, which can be around 33 inches or more.

Monitoring tire pressure accurately: Utilize a quality tire pressure gauge. A study conducted by the Tire Industry Association in 2020 emphasizes the importance of maintaining proper tire pressure for off-road vehicles. Under-inflated tires can increase the risk of tire damage and reduce fuel efficiency. The recommended pressure for off-road tires often ranges from 10 to 15 PSI depending on the loading and specific tire design.

Considering the terrain: Adjust tire pressure according to the terrain. Lower tire pressure increases the tire’s footprint, improving traction on soft surfaces like sand or mud. However, higher pressure is preferable on rocky or hard surfaces to prevent tire damage. It is advisable to adjust the pressure before entering challenging terrain and reinflate to normal settings afterward.

Using safety equipment: Carry safety equipment like tire plugs and a repair kit. A study by the International Rubber Study Group in 2021 reported that on-the-go repairs can prevent full tire failures in off-road conditions. This toolset allows for emergency repairs and quick tire inspections, enhancing overall safety during off-road adventures.

Regular tire inspections: Conduct regular inspections before and after off-road activities. Check for visible damage, punctures, and tread wear. A report from the National Highway Traffic Safety Administration in 2019 noted that regular checks can significantly reduce the risk of tire failure. Proper maintenance prolongs tire life and ensures your vehicle’s safety.

By following these guidelines, you can ensure safe and effective tire inflation in off-road conditions.
